The Encyclopedia of Vaudeville
Anthony Slide
Typical of the ethnic balancing and acrobatic acts was the On Wah Troupe, three Chinese men and two women popular in the late 1920s and early 1930s who engaged in contortions, balancing plates on end of poles, and similar feats. Apparently the group consisted of a father and his four children, but as The Billboard (April 19, 1930) put it, after viewing the act at Fox's Academy, "can't be sure, however, as all Chinese look alike". - Развлечения
